Abstract

Postmodernism is a philosophical movement that comprises many perspectives. Feminism is a postmodern perspective and deals with all genders having equal rights and opportunities. Liberal feminism is one of the branches of feminism. Liberal feminism is concerned with women and their suffering, especially how they overcome all the impediments and make decisions independently. The aim of the study is to delve into the postmodern perspective of liberal feminism in Preeti Shenoy’s selected texts, The Secret Wish List (2012), Tea for Two and a Piece of Cake (2014) and It Happens for a Reason (2014). Preeti Shenoy is a famous Indian postmodern writer, and her contributions to liberal feminism cannot be denied. Liberal feminism is part of the feminist movement; it deals with women protagonists and their suffering. From those sufferings, they liberate and take all the decisions independently. Liberal feminism elucidates women empowerment. The precursors of liberal feminism and distinguished thinkers associated with the movement include Mary Wollstonecraft, John Stuart Mill, Susan Moller Okin, Martha Nussbaum and Zillah Eisenstein. The present study has adopted the elements of liberal feminism as presented in their works. The methodology of the study has adopted the concepts of liberal feminism such as moral theory, theory of justice, advocating educational and social equity for women, constructing a theory of capitalist patriarchy and socialist feminism, and capability approach. These theories substantiate the aspects of liberal feminism as manifested in Shenoy’s selected works. The results of the study are evaluated with other studies considering liberal feminism.
